Lasting Products



When preparing your environmentally friendly washroom remodel, think about utilizing sustainable materials to decrease your environmental effect. Choosing lasting materials not just minimizes the deficiency of natural deposits but additionally helps in creating a healthier interior setting for you and your family.

Among the very first lasting materials you can use is bamboo. Bamboo is a fast-growing lawn that can be collected and restored rapidly. It's strong, resilient, and can be used for floor covering, counter tops, and even as a product for shower room devices like toothbrush owners and soap dishes.

Energy-Efficient Fixtures



To even more minimize your environmental influence and develop an energy-efficient washroom, consider upgrading to energy-efficient components. These components not only aid you reduce power costs but also add to a greener planet.

Right here are 5 energy-efficient components to consider for your shower room remodel:

- Low-Flow Showerheads: Set up low-flow showerheads to lower water intake while maintaining a refreshing shower experience.

- Dual-Flush Toilets: Update to dual-flush toilets that provide the choice of a full flush for solid waste and a partial flush for liquid waste, conserving water with each usage.

- Motion-Sensor Faucets: Select motion-sensor taps that instantly switch off when not in use, protecting against water wastefulness.

- Energy-Efficient Air Flow Fans: Mount energy-efficient ventilation fans that remove excess dampness from the washroom while using much less electrical energy.

Water Conservation Strategies



Take into consideration carrying out water conservation methods to decrease water waste and promote lasting practices in your restroom remodel.

By taking on these approaches, you can help in reducing your water consumption and add to the preservation of this priceless resource.

One efficient method is to mount low-flow fixtures, such as low-flow toilets and showerheads. These fixtures are made to restrict water flow, without endangering on efficiency. By utilizing much less water per flush or shower, you can substantially minimize your water usage.

An additional water conservation technique is to deal with any leakages in your washroom. Also small leaks can add up to a substantial amount of water waste in time. Frequently check for leakages in your taps, pipes, and commodes, and repair them immediately to prevent unneeded water loss.

In addition, think about executing a greywater system in your bathroom remodel. Greywater describes the fairly tidy wastewater from showers, bathtubs, and sinks. By installing a greywater system, you can catch and reuse this water for objectives like flushing commodes or sprinkling plants. This not just lowers water intake but likewise assists stop pollution by diverting wastewater away from sewage systems.

Finally, exercising conscious water usage behaviors can make a large distinction. Easy actions like switching off the faucet while brushing your teeth or taking much shorter showers can considerably reduce water waste.
